IDF在vscode中编译,使用sdkconfig.h问题

lihyxx
Posts: 4
Joined: Mon Jun 28, 2021 8:19 am

IDF在vscode中编译,使用sdkconfig.h问题

Postby lihyxx » Thu Sep 30, 2021 12:46 am

ESP32S2使用VSCODE编译,在调用sdkconfig.h头文件时,总是会调用 build->bootLoader->config->sdkconfig.h文件,但是正确的文件在build->config->sdkconfig.h

lingcoln
Posts: 1
Joined: Sun Oct 01, 2023 8:11 am

Re: IDF在vscode中编译,使用sdkconfig.h问题

Postby lingcoln » Mon Oct 09, 2023 2:34 pm

在c_cpp_properties.json文件里添加 "${workspaceFolder}/build/config"

Code: Select all

{
    "configurations": [
        {
            "name": "MACOS",
            "includePath": [
                "${workspaceFolder}/**",
                "${workspaceFolder}/include/**",
                "${workspaceFolder}/components/**",
                "/Users/esp32/.espressif/esp-mdf/components/**",
                "/Users/esp32/.espressif/esp-mdf/esp-idf/components/**",
                "${workspaceFolder}/build/config"
            ],
            "defines": [
                "_DEBUG",
                "UNICODE",
                "_UNICODE"
            ],
            "cStandard": "c17",
            "cppStandard": "c++17",
            "compilerPath": "/Users/esp32/.espressif/tools/xtensa-esp32-elf/esp-2021r1-8.4.0/xtensa-esp32-elf/bin/xtensa-esp32-elf-gcc",
            "intelliSenseMode": "macos-gcc-x64",
            "browse": {
                "path": [
                    "${workspaceFolder}/",
                    "${workspaceFolder}/include/",
                    "${workspaceFolder}/components/",
                    "/Users/esp32/.espressif/esp-mdf/components/",
                    "/Users/esp32/.espressif/esp-mdf/esp-idf/components/",
                    "${workspaceFolder}/build/config"
                ]
            }
        }
    ],
    "version": 4
}

Who is online

Users browsing this forum: No registered users and 134 guests